What Causes Dizziness Followed By Pupils Dilation And Tingling Sensation In Left Arm?
I had an episode of dizziness while sithing at my desk at work. Shortly after I looked in mirror and my pupils were unevenly dilated. Then shortly after that had tingling in my left arm down to my fingertips followed by dull pain. It let uo. Today feeling very drained with a headache when I woke up. Is any of this a concern or something I should follow up with? I m 54 yo female, never smoked. Very healthy and low BP always.
Hi Thanks for posting on HCM Dizziness, unevenly dilated pupils, tingling in left hand are not symptoms to take lightly as it may reveal serious medical conditions like stroke, neurologic disorders, metabolic/ionic imbalances.I will suggest you see the Doctor immediately for examination and a brain CT scan to exclude a stroke as it is a very probable cause given youe age.Low BP may predispose to ischemia as hemmorrhage mostly seen with high BP.
